Legalities
 
The legal status of the pay for sex in Aberllefenni industry varies substantially across the globe, with some countries embracing a more permissive approach, while others impose stringent penalties and even criminalize the act altogether.
 
Decriminalization: In some jurisdictions, such as New Zealand, the act of exchanging sex for cash is not considered illegal, and sex work is treated as a genuine occupation. This approach has been applauded for focusing on the safety and rights of sex workers.
 
Legalization: Nations such as Germany and the Netherlands have actually legislated prostitution and executed policies to govern the industry, such as mandatory registration, health checks, and tax. Advocates argue that this approach helps in reducing exploitation and human trafficking.
 
Criminalization: In other parts of the world, such as the United States (with the exception of some counties in Nevada) and much of Africa, Asia, and the Middle East, both the buying and selling of sex are strictly restricted and punishable by law.
